This uncirculated 5 Tajikistani diram banknote is a standard circulation banknote issued by the National Bank of Tajikistan. It is a blue banknote that is dated 1999, bear the signatures of Murodali Alimardon and Sharif Rahimzoda, and measures 110 mm x 60 mm. Its obverse side shows the national coat of arms and the Culture Palace in Urunkhosjaev. Its reverse side depicts the sepulcher in the Chiluchorchashma locality of the Shahritus District. Security features include a solid security thread with printed Tajik text and a watermark of the bank logo with an electrotype 5.
